James Coburn, as Cunningham, accepts the deal dished out by Burgess Meredith. Leaving the US for Torremelinos, he meets the self-indulgent jet-set quartet who bloom in the Spanish sun.
Leader of the group is Lee Remick, who finds herself in love with Coburn but not his profession.
Scenery of Spain and Belgium is in sharp focus, which isn't always true of story. A shift of values has been initiated, but no one has raised a signpost to tell where we're going.
Coburn and Remick, effective in their roles, allow characters to develop naturally.
(Color) Widescreen. Extract of a review from 1969. Running time: 106 MIN.
